About 4 April Place

A plain-English summary derived from public records, EPC certificates, sold prices and local data.

4 April Place is a two-bedroom property in Slough (SL1 5BP). It has a recorded floor area of 68 m² (around 733 sq ft) and construction records dating it to 1950-1966. The latest certificate (May 2010) shows an E (score 54), well below the UK norm with real room to improve. The recommended improvements would lift it to C (score 72), a 2-band jump. The latest certificate is from May 2010, so improvements made since then won't be reflected. The home occupies a cul-de-sac position.

On energy efficiency it sits in the bottom 10% of properties in this postcode — significant headroom for improvement. Most recent transfer: November 2019 at £410,000. Across the public record there are 6 sales, relatively high churn for a single property. Across 2001–2019, sale prices on this property compounded at 7.9% per year.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£559/sq ft) was about 157.3% above the typical sold price in the postcode.
